The Veterans Affairs Department says it’s always had plans to reorganize and restructure its workforce — executive order or not.
So when the president — and the Office of Management and Budget — charged agencies to develop comprehensive reform plans to reorganize, the VA already had the basics in mind.
VA Secretary David Shulkin laid out his own priorities and charged his leadership to make aggressive and ambitious plans to start fulfilling them even before President Donald Trump signed a reorganization executive order and OMB issued subsequent guidance for federal agencies.
